E3 2014: Uncharted 4: A Thief’s End trailer shows an older, semi-retired Drake

Drake and Sully set out on the fourth, and maybe final, game in the Uncharted series.

Adding the subtitle of ‘A Thief’s End’ is rather ominous, as is the voiceover that runs along the video. Nathan Drake has become one of the biggest stars in the game world, and Naughty Dog has made a serious name for themselves with the IP since its debut on the PS3. Now on the PS4, Uncharted makes its first impressions in a trailer that could spell doom for Drake, his partner Sully, or both of them really as when you get down to it, they’re really both ‘thieves’.

If it is the end of this chapter, it’s also possible that we’ll be seeing the introduction of another treasure hunter to take Nate’s place in the series. Who that might be (if that’s the case) certainly hasn’t been revealed as of yet as this is the very first mention of the title in any capacity. One thing is already certain though, with this footage being captured right off a console, this is going to be one good looking adventure- whenever we might see it gracing the PlayStation 4.
